This morning Nick Hession and I explore creative ways to get your kids up and out the door this morning, We all know that getting out the door for school and work can be a battle. We discuss some of the things we do to make mornings a little less of a fire drill and more of a fine-tuned pit crew.
Pro Tips
- Jody shares a song he made up that he sings to the kids
- Wake your kids gradually
- Turn lights on, say good morning, give them hugs
- Let your dogs help ;)
- Set up multiple alarms for yourself so that you don’t keep hitting snooze
- Avoid the stress of unintentionally creating a fire drill
- Hit them with pillows
- Play nice music in the background
- Make your morning smooth by having a plan (a battle plan)
- Give yourself time before getting the kids up; workout, read, watch Sports Center
